Recipe Book Background
At the last minute I've decided I'd like to do up a booklet of recipes for my daughters. It will contain my mom's (their grandmother's) old favorites which they love.
Can anyone help with where I can find a suitable background and cover page that is already designed, to make this quicker. Perhaps a style that suggests an earlier time period ? I should probably post this in the scrapper's section as well. Thank you!

Pat ...
I don't know where you could get one already done but why not take a photograph (one that will mean something to your daughters ... say one of your Mother) make it sepia the put a white layer beneath it and reduce the opacity of the photograph until it only just shows. All you need to do then is add text ... and it will make it much more personal for them.Wendy
